mirror of
https://github.com/yggdrasil-network/yggdrasil-go.git
synced 2025-06-17 06:35:07 +03:00
Revamped GET /api/peers response format
This commit is contained in:
parent
0ff6a63df5
commit
b129d689a3
2 changed files with 4 additions and 4 deletions
|
@ -279,12 +279,12 @@ ui.getConnectedPeers = () =>
|
|||
fetch('api/peers')
|
||||
.then((response) => response.json())
|
||||
|
||||
ui.updateConnectedPeersHandler = (cont) => {
|
||||
ui.updateConnectedPeersHandler = (peers) => {
|
||||
$("peers").innerText = "";
|
||||
const regexStrip = /%[^\]]*/gm;
|
||||
const regexMulticast = /:\/\/\[fe80::/;
|
||||
const sorted = cont.peers.map(peer => ({"url": peer["remote"], "isMulticast": peer["remote"].match(regexMulticast)}))
|
||||
.sort((a, b) => a.isMulticast > b.isMulticast);
|
||||
const sorted = peers.map(peer => ({"url": peer["remote"], "isMulticast": peer["remote"].match(regexMulticast)}))
|
||||
.sort((a, b) => a.isMulticast > b.isMulticast);
|
||||
sorted.forEach(peer => {
|
||||
let row = $("peers").appendChild(document.createElement('div'));
|
||||
row.className = "overflow-ellipsis"
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ue